Hello, tell me how to add a third-party font to the wwb project?
I add the font manually "font-options-manually specify @ font-face font" but it does not appear in fonts.
The font appears only when I load the fonts on the computer into the folder.

Re: How to add a third-party font to the project
1. Install the font in Windows
2. Add it to the websafe safe list
3. Configure @font-face
